Know What Your Needs Are

Just because a business is considered small, doesn’t necessarily mean that it doesn’t require lots of support. You must consider what your financial data entails in order to determine if a CPA will suffice or if you need to consult with an accounting firm. However, if you are just starting out, you will probably want to hire an individual and scale your team as your business grows.

Look for Industry Experience

Although you can technically hire an accountant who has the general experience, if you want to receive the most tax breaks, you should choose someone who is well-versed in your industry. Not only will they be able to help you save money during tax season, but they can also offer better financial advice.

When choosing a small business CPA in Columbus, it is important that you find someone who is not only experienced but also reputable. If you have friends or family members who own businesses, you can ask for a referral. Otherwise, do your research online and gather as much information about a potential CPA in order to find the best one for your company.
